Linux数据库全攻略:极速安装至深度优化硬核指南

Linux系统中安装数据库是许多开发人员和系统管理员的日常任务。选择合适的数据库类型是第一步,常见的有MySQL、PostgreSQL、MariaDB等。每种数据库都有其特点,根据应用需求选择最为关键。

安装过程通常通过包管理器完成,如Ubuntu使用apt,CentOS使用yum或dnf。以MySQL为例,执行`sudo apt update`更新源后,运行`sudo apt install mysql-server`即可开始安装。安装过程中会提示设置root密码,务必妥善保存。

安装完成后,需要启动服务并设置开机自启。使用`systemctl start mysql`启动服务,`systemctl enable mysql`确保开机自动运行。可以通过`mysql -u root -p`登录数据库,验证是否安装成功。

数据库配置文件通常位于/etc/mysql/目录下,修改配置前建议备份原文件。调整参数如最大连接数、缓存大小等,可以提升性能。修改后需重启服务使更改生效。

优化数据库性能可以从多个方面入手,包括索引优化、查询语句优化和硬件资源分配。定期清理无用数据、监控慢查询日志也是保持数据库高效运行的重要手段。

安全性同样不可忽视,设置强密码、限制远程访问、定期备份数据都是必要的措施。使用SSL加密连接可进一步增强安全性,防止数据泄露。

AI生成的趋势图,仅供参考

深度优化需要结合实际应用场景,持续监控数据库状态,分析性能瓶颈,逐步调整配置。掌握这些技能,能够显著提升Linux环境下数据库的稳定性和效率。

dawei

【声明】:唐山站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复